Jobs via eFinancialCareers is looking for a Business Analyst based in Edinburgh, focused on OTC derivatives within Security Services. The ideal candidate will help deliver scalable transaction management solutions by collaborating with both business and technology teams.
Responsibilities include:
- Translating business requirements
- Documenting processes
- Providing solution design expertise
Strong knowledge of OTC products and trade life-cycle experience is essential.
